What Does “Without Sublimits” Meaning in Travel Insurance?

In overseas travel medical insurance, without sublimit means the insurance company covers for your medical expenses up to the limit mentioned in the policy schedule. If you are holding a policy which is comprehensive. Then you are covered up to the limits for that eligible medical claim or non medical claim.


You can understand this how it works with an example.

Let us assume that you have travel medical insurance which covers $100,000 for your medical expenses without any medical sublimits. There is a admissible claim with this policy of $25,000. The break up of medical expenses is listed below.

  • Xray and lab tests = $2,500
  • Surgery = $12,000
  • Room rent = $1,500 for 3 days
Total claim amount is $19,000

As you have a policy with no sublimit and claim is payable, then the insurance company pays you 100% of the claim amount i.e.$19,000. If the benefit has a deductible, then deductible amount should be paid by you, before the insurance company settles the claim.

What Is the Difference Between a Limit and a Sublimit?

With the simple comparison we can understand in a better way.

Parameter Limit Sublimit
Definition Limit is the overall maximum amount your policy will pay for covered expenses. A sublimit or sub limit is a specific cap on how much you can claim for certain benefits within that overall policy limit
Example A Tata AIG policy with $50,000 for medical expenses means all eligible medical expenses combined together during your trip. A Tata AIG policy with $50,000 for medical expenses with sublimit on room rent $2,000 per day and maximum 2 days, Surgery $10,000. If there is surgery bill of $12,000. You will get only $10,000 as there is a caping on surgery.

How Do These Sublimits in TATA AIG Travel Insurance Plans Work?

Sublimits are specific caps on certain benefits in a travel insurance plan. They are part of the overall sum insured and do not provide extra coverage; instead, they set a maximum amount payable for specific medical expenses. Sublimits can be a fixed dollar amount or a percentage of the coverage.

In TATA AIG travel insurance, sublimits usually apply to travelers aged 56 years and above. Certain benefits, such as hospital room rent, surgery, ICU, ambulance, and diagnostic tests, may have a maximum limit.

For example:
  • You need surgery costing $12,000, but your plan has a surgery sublimit of $10,000.
  • The insurance company will pay $10,000, even though you have a higher sum insured.
💡 Travelers can waive sublimits by paying an additional premium, ensuring full coverage up to the policy maximum for all eligible medical expenses.

Cost Comparison: Plans With vs Without Sublimit

Example: Why No Sub limit Coverage Matters

Mr. Ramesh, aged 58, traveled to the U.S. for three months. He was involved in an accident and was hospitalized for 2 days. The total bill came to USD 16,000. With a regular plan he stayed 2 days in hospital with 1 day in ICU $3,000 that capped room rent at USD 1,500 per day and surgery at USD 10,000, his reimbursement was only USD 14,000. With a no-sublimit plan, the full amount (minus deductible) would have been paid.

Feature TATA AIG Plan with Sublimits TATA AIG Plan without Sublimits
Room rent limit USD 1,500 / day No cap — up to policy limit
Surgery cost limit USD 10,000 / incident No cap — up to policy limit
ICU limit USD 2,000 / day No cap — up to policy limit
Premium Lower Slightly higher
Ideal for Budget travelers Long term / senior travelers

Travel Insurance Premiums for a 56-Year-Old Traveler Visiting the UK for 1 Month

The table below shows a simple premium comparison for different travel insurance plans available for a 56-year-old traveler visiting the UK for one month. The premiums vary based on policy coverage limits and whether the plan includes sublimits.

Plan Name Policy maximum (US $) With Sublimit Without Sublimit
$50,000 ₹1,574 ₹1,974
$1,00,000 ₹1,900 ₹2,498
$2,50,000 ₹2,215 ₹3,188
$5,00,000 ₹2,570 ₹3,366

    What is sublimit in travel insurance?

    In simple terms, a sub-limit is a cap on certain benefits in your travel insurance policy. It means that for specific treatments or services, the insurance will pay only up to a fixed amount, even if your total sum insured is higher. Sub-limits can be a fixed amount or a percentage of the total sum insured.

    In TATA AIG travel insurance, sub-limits typically apply to travelers aged 56 years and above.

    Benefit Name Benefit Amount
    Ambulance Charges $400
    Hospital Room rent, Board and Hospital miscellaneous $1,500 per day up to 30 days.
    Intensive Care Unit $3,000 per day up to 7 days.
    Surgical Treatment $10,000
    Anesthetist Services up to 25% of Surgical Treatment
    Physician's Visit $75 per day up to 10 visits
    Diagnostic and Pre-Admission Testing up to $500

    What does "without sublimit" mean in insurance?

    Without sublimit meaning in insurance is that your policy does not place separate caps on specific treatments or services. The full sum insured is available for any single eligible claim — whether it's surgery, hospitalisation, or ICU care — without internal restrictions.


    What does no sub limit mean in insurance?

    No sub limit in insurance means there is no separate cap on specific benefits like room rent, surgery, or ICU charges. Your insurer pays any eligible expense up to the total policy limit — so a $50,000 policy can be used fully for a single hospitalisation if needed, without internal restrictions cutting into your claim.
